Patch to allow configure options to set Boost header and lib locations

The default (at least in 1.35) Boost install locations are in /usr/local 
(/usr/local/include/boost-1_35/boost and /usr/local/lib). These locations are 
not searched by g++ without additional options. This patch allows the following 
options to be supplied to the configure script:

--with-boost=DIR
--with-boost-include=DIR
--with-boost-libdir=DIR

The patch also includes changes related to 1068 (the first section from line 26)

+# Allow Boost to be somewhere that requires compile and/or link options.
+qpid_BOOST_CPPFLAGS=""
+qpid_BOOST_LDFLAGS=""
+AC_ARG_WITH([boost],
+   AS_HELP_STRING([--with-boost@<:@=DIR@:>@],
+                 [root directory of Boost installation]),
+   [
+   qpid_boost_root="${withval}"
+   if test "${qpid_boost_root}" != yes; then
+       qpid_boost_include="${qpid_boost_root}/include"
+       qpid_boost_libdir="${qpid_boost_root}/lib"
+   fi
+   ])
+
+AC_ARG_WITH([boost-include],
+   AS_HELP_STRING([--with-boost-include=DIR],
+                  [specify exact directory for Boost headers]),
+   [qpid_boost_include="$withval"])
+
+AC_ARG_WITH([boost-libdir],
+   AS_HELP_STRING([--with-boost-libdir=DIR],
+                  [specify exact directory for Boost libraries]),
+   [qpid_boost_libdir="$withval"])
+
+if test "${qpid_boost_include}"; then
+   CPPFLAGS="$CPPFLAGS -I${qpid_boost_include}"
+fi
+
+if test "${qpid_boost_libdir}"; then
+   LDFLAGS="$LDFLAGS -L${qpid_boost_libdir}"
+fi
+
